Webb9 sep. 2024 · Propulsion Patterns. There are four push stroke techniques consisting of a push phase and a recovery phase. The pattern of recovery (release to contact) is the largest difference between techniques. The hand follows an elliptical pattern with no quick changes in direction and no extra hand movements. Webb6 dec. 2024 · The study included 27 wheelchair propulsion tests of a wheelchair with pushrim propulsion using the following variable parameters: gear ratio of the propulsion system, propulsion frequency and wheelchair tilt angle. The position of the centre of gravity of the human body was measured in dynamic conditions at 100 Hz.
